First of all, that would be incredibly hard as players would easily find ways to trick the artificial intelligence into making even worse decisions than they did before, making this not a viable update.
Second of all, the reason that raiding is difficult is the AI. Attackers need to be aware of it to execute efficient raids, and defenders need to be aware of it to take advantage of it in intricate funneling and advanced trap techniques.

The ai is far...far from perfect and could use some improving.
Barbs...very rarely go where you'd like them to. I've had them go through a blown wall destroy whatever was there and then end up going back out outside and start going around the village only to get killed off by mortars and archers. When they ideally they should of attacked the next wall with my giants and keep going on the inside.
I've seen Barbs attack a wall and then stop and go after other random things that archers had been attacking. OR the most annoying is when barbs ignore the HQ in the center and go around the inside of a base and die.
Giants seem to be ok, they generally go after the def as intended.
Archers seem ok, but in some cases don't attack the selected target even though you place them infront of it.
Goblins imo could use a bit more health.
Wizards are ok, they generally do what I want them to.
That's as far as Ive gotten with my troop build. 3-4 star on them. The other thing that bugs me a lot is when your minions are under attack and ignore it. Example.. when attacking a random wall instead of killing off a nearby cannon or archer tower or any other def. OR attacking a resource when they could be attacking a nearby mortar or other def.
Simply put the AI of minions is lame and utterly frustrating at times no matter how hard you try to make them attack what you want, many times they don't. Barbs for the most part need to be made smarter. All minions need better pathfinding and target of importance upgrading.
